Summary: I'm running some new workshops loosely based on some of the later chapters in the book, aimed at discussing some intermediate TDD issues: the outside-in approach, and the pros and cons of mocks and test isolation. | ||
|
||
After many successful years of running my beginners' TDD/django tutorial, I | ||
thought it might be time to have a crack at some more intermediate-level | ||
topics, so I'm announcing a couple of workshops. | ||
